Deanna Jean Skillett (Wallace), age 70, passed away peacefully Saturday, October 4, 2025, at her home in Shawnee, OK surrounded by family.
She was born on December 6, 1954, in Burlington, KS to Wayne and Wilma Wallace (Farmers). Deanna graduated Waverly High School in 1972. She married her loving husband James “Jim” Skillett of fifty-two years on July 1, 1972, at the Methodist Church in Waverly, KS. In 1982 Jim and Deanna moved to Texas with their two sons.
Deanna was a homemaker for the first fifteen years of their marriage before working as a daycare provider for ten years and began her studies to further her education. She graduated from McLennan Community College in 1997 and started her twenty-two-year career as a Respiratory Therapist helping many patients over the years. Deanna enjoyed working at the hospital in Pulmonary Rehab until her retirement. Deanna loved sewing, embroidery, making Native American regalia, crochet, camping, traveling, kayaking, cruise ships, motorcycle riding, Blue Grass music, and played many string instruments. As Jim says, “she didn’t let the grass grow under her feet”. She worked for many years with the Boy Scouts and achieved many awards. Deanna loved singing in the choir, playing bells, and Bible Study at church where she spent many hours over the years. She loved making wedding and birthday cakes for people all over. She and Jim would travel to deliver and set up cakes for family and friends. Deanna always had a cake pan for any character or event to help celebrate everyone’s special occasion. Her precious joy was her children, her grandchildren, her great grandchildren along with her nieces and nephews. Deanna had a long battle with Crohn’s Disease and cancer twice. Deanna and her beautiful smile will be missed by so many.
Deanna Jean Skillett is preceded in death by her parents Wayne and Wilma Wallace and her brother Darl Wallace. Deanna is survived by her husband James “Jim” Skillett; her two sons Kenneth (Erin) and Curt (Kala); grandchildren Elizabeth (Edward), Sarah, Bradley and Kasey; four great grandchildren; her brother David Wallace along with many nephews and nieces.
Funeral service will be held at 11:00 a.m., Saturday, October 11, 2025, at Jones VanArsdale Funeral Home in Lebo. Family will receive friends an hour before service at funeral home. Interment will follow service at Lincoln Cemetery in Lebo. In lieu of flowers, memorial contributions may be made to the American Cancer Society or the church of your choice.
